Abstract

Official abstract text for this publication.

Natural navigational guidance provides enhanced guidance instructions that take advantage of unique geographic features along a navigated route to specify maneuver points. Guidance points are clearly visible, unambiguous, and locally unique features in the geography of the maneuver area that can be used to aid the user in discovering the place where the maneuver point is. Within a guidance point selection area, a specific guidance point type has a more strict area within which it can be used. A natural guidance point selection area for an upcoming maneuver to be navigated is determined, and a unique geographic feature within the determined natural guidance point selection area is selected as a natural guidance point for navigation of the upcoming maneuver. A turn-type natural guidance point for an upcoming maneuver to be navigated is generated when the user device is within the natural guidance point selection area.

First claim

Opening claim text (preview).

1 - 19 . (canceled) 20 . A method of providing audible natural navigational guidance output from a wireless device, comprising: measuring a current location and direction of travel of a wireless device with respect to an upcoming maneuver point along a navigated route; determining a natural guidance point selection area relating to said upcoming maneuver point; identifying a plurality of locally unique geographic features within said determined natural guidance point selection area; varying a priority of each of said plurality of locally unique geographic features within said determined natural guidance point selection area based on a proximity to said upcoming maneuver point; and outputting audio from said wireless device, said audio relating to one of said plurality of locally unique geographic features having a highest varied priority. 21 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, further comprising: outputting audio relating to a prepare to-type guidance outside said natural guidance point selection area. 23 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ein types of said plurality of locally unique geographic features comprise: a railroad track; a traffic light; a stop sign; an end of road; a bridge; and a street count. 24 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ein said first priority of said plurality of locally unique geographic features, before being varied, is given in a descending order of priority as follows: a traffic light, a stop sign, an end of road, a railroad track, a bridge, and a street count. 25 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ein: said first starting priority of said plurality of locally unique geographic features, before being varied, is configurable in a network navigation server accessible to said wireless device. 26 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, further comprising: determining a location on said navigated route at which to begin outputting said audio from said wireless device based on a type of said one of said plurality of locally unique geographic features having said highest varied priority. 27 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ein said wireless device comprises: a smartphone. 28 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ein said wireless device comprises: a tablet. 29 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ein: said natural guidance point selection area does not include area behind said measured current location and direction of travel of said wireless device. 30 . The method of providing audible natural navigational guidance output from a wireless device according to claim 20 , wherein: said audio is output from said wireless device as said wireless device approaches said one of said plurality of locally unique geographic features having said highest varied priority within said natural guidance point selection area. 31 . A method of providing audible natural navigational guidance output from a wireless device, comprising: measuring a current location and direction of travel of a wireless device with respect to an upcoming maneuver point along a navigated route; determining a natural guidance point selection area relating to said upcoming maneuver point; identifying a plurality of locally unique geographic features within said determined natural guidance point selection area, each of said plurality of locally unique geographic features having a first priority based on a type of geographic feature; varying said priority of each of said plurality of locally unique geographic features based on a proximity to said upcoming maneuver point; and outputting audio from said wireless device, said audio relating to one of said plurality of locally unique geographic features having a highest varied priority. 32 .
